ROYAL SHOW AWARDS

(WANGANUI AND DISTRICT SUCCESSES i Wanganui and district award win|ners at the Royal Show, Palmerston North, yesterday were: - CATTLE. Ayshires: Heifers, 3-year-old in milk, A. C. Birch’s (Marton) Thoresby Angell, 1. Heifer, dry, calved since June 1, 1947. A. C. Birch's (Marton) Thoresby Blueprint- v.h.c. Milking Shorthorns: Cow in milk, calved prior June 1, 1946: Horrocks Bros. (Makirikiri) Highland Hazel, 1. Heifer in milk, calved since June 1. 1946: G. Sims’ (Brunswick) Brunswick Beryl, 3. Female, dry, born prior to June 1, 1947: G. Sims’ (Brunswick) Pinedale Ella 2nd, 1. Heifer calved between June 1 and September 30, 1948: Horrocks Bros.’ Penworthan Emily, 3. Heifer, calved since June 1, 1949: G. Sims' Brunswick Star, 2. Bull, calved since June 1. 1949; Horrocks Bros.’ Penworthan Eclipse, 1. Two yearling heifers, calved since June 1, 1948: Horrocks Bros.’ Penworthan Emily and Penworthan Eliza- 1. Grades and crossbreds: Heifers, calved since June 1, 1949: W. C. Hill’s (Marton) Blue Bells, 3. Herefords: Bull calved since July 1. 1948: E. T. Cranstone's (Fordell) Riverton Maizena, 2 and Riverton Mandarin 3. HORSES. Saddle ponies: Pony stallion. 12.2 to 14.2 hands: Mrs. J. A. Takarangi’s (Wanganui) Bahrup, v.h.c. Pony stallion, 12.2 hands and under: J. C. Williams’ (Wanganui) Robert. 1. Pony mare or gelding, 11.2 to 12.2 hands, boy or girl rider under 14: Nola Carveil’s (Wanganui) Sylvia; 1. Pony mare or gelding, 11.2 hands and under, boy or girl rider under 12: Graham Lennox’s (Waverley) Trixie. 1. Pace and mannered pony, 12.2 to 14.2 hands: Nola Carvell’s Sylvia 1. Boy rider, under 17: John Gray (Patea) 3. Saddle Horses: Woman’s hack, not exceeding 15 hands, to be shown in saddle and ridden by woman: R. Hall’s (Hunterville) Brown Bee. 2. Mare or gelding, in saddle, up to 11 stone: Rex Hall's Brown Bee 3. Mare or gelding, most suitable for hunter, flat rider only: Miss Noel Cameron’s (Turakina) Kodiak, 3. SHEEP. Corriedale: Ram 30 months and over: I. F. Gordon (Utiku) 2 and 3. Ewe, 30 months and over, with lamb: I. F. Gordon 2. Ewe, 18 to 30 months: I. F. Gordon 2 and v.h.c. Ewe hoggets, under 18 months: I. F. Gordon, v.h.c. Southdowns (natural conditions): Ram hoggets under 18 monthsr S. F. Besley (Waverley) 2. Ram to 30 months and over: T. W. Pairman (Mangaweka) 1. Ryelands: Ram hogget under 18 months: B. U. McKenzie and Son (Wanganui) 3. Shorn ram hogget, under 30 months: McKenzie 3 and v.h.c. Ewe, 30 months and over, with lamb at foot: McKenzie and Son 3. Ewe, 18 to 30 months with lamb: McKenzie and Son 1. Two ewe hoggets, under 18 months: McKenzie and Son. 1. Shorn ewe hogget, under 18 months: McKenzie and Son. 1 and 2.
